The DHS shutdown and U.S. immigration policies could hinder the World Cup

Category: News & Politics
Duration: 00:10:38
Publish Date: 2026-04-19 20:11:21
Description: The FIFA 2026 World Cup kicks off in June and 11 American host cities are getting ready for an influx of fans. Juliette Kayyem, a national security expert and former DHS official, examines how the partial government shutdown has impacted preparedness for the mega event.
